Result Declaration of the Debate Event

Vis-a-Vis | Debate | Electrical Engineering Society

The Electrical Engineering Society proudly announces the successful conclusion and result declaration of the Debate Event conducted under Vis-a-Vis, a platform dedicated to the exchange of ideas, logic, and thoughtful discourse.

After a series of intellectually stimulating rounds, the debate event reached its culmination with the declaration of results, marking the end of a journey that celebrated critical thinking, confident expression, and respectful disagreement.

About the Event

The debate competition under Vis-a-Vis was curated to encourage students to voice their perspectives on contemporary, technical, and socially relevant topics. Participants were evaluated not merely on their ability to speak, but on the depth of their arguments, clarity of thought, rebuttal skills, and overall presentation.

The event witnessed enthusiastic participation from students of First Year, each bringing unique insights and interpretations. Every round reflected intense preparation, logical reasoning, and a commendable spirit of healthy competition.

 However, beyond rankings and titles, every participant emerged as a winner having gained experience, confidence, and a broader perspective. 

The Electrical Engineering Society congratulates all winners and extends heartfelt appreciation to every participant who made Vis-a-Vis a meaningful and memorable event.

The result declaration of the Debate Event under Vis-a-Vis marks not just the end of a competition, but the beginning of stronger voices and sharper minds. The success of the event reinforces EES’s commitment to nurturing engineers who can think, question, and communicate with clarity and responsibility.

Inaguration of Tesla Hall: EES Library & Meeting Room

On 24th November 2018, the meeting room and library of EES, the Tesla Hall, was inaugurated by the hands of Alumni of the 1993 batch of the department in presence of Prof. Bharti Dwivedi ma'am. The inauguration was scheduled on the occasion of Convergence'18, the Silver Jubilee program of 1989-93 batch of the institute. The work of the library was started after it was announced in the Teacher's Day program. By the hard work of the Library Committee and other active members of EES from 2nd and 3rd year, the library has again come to a state to operate for the welfare of the students of the society. Special thanks to HOD sir, Prof. Kuldeep Sahay for providing curtains and a  roundtable along with cousin chairs for the hall. Also, head sir has agreed to give a desktop and a printer for the library. The society has also arranged a whiteboard, a clock and sheets for the windows from its fund.
